I'm sure all of you have felt the hesitation of the z22se between 2500 and 3500 rpm before it really starts to pull. Well having had my car on the rollers about three times now over the past couple of years, along with several other 2.2 owners its aparent that its a charicteristic of the engine and is shown in the torque curve pictured bellow.

Theres nothing wrong with my engine, you really can overlay this curve with any other 2.2's rolloing road results and they will have the same dip. Ive even seen the graph of a 2.2 with every debias acssesory feasable fitted, including inlet and exhaust manifold, cams, sports cat and remap, and it had the same dip in torqe. Not quite as bad but it was still there!
So what is it? what can we do to make it a nice smooth progressive torque curve? The around town pull of the engine would be superb if we could get rid of that dip!
